Aston Villa to avoid defeat against Newcastle. Despite Newcastle’s impressive home record last season, including a 4-0 victory over Villa pre-Unai Emery era, the landscape has dramatically changed since.

Emery has ushered in a significant upswing in Villa’s fortunes, enhancing their competitive edge. Concurrently, while Newcastle has made progress under Eddie Howe and is bolstered by big-money summer signings, their continuity-focused approach under the current owners does not assure an immediate impact.

Considering Villa’s resurgence and the uncertainties in Newcastle’s adaptation to their new signings, the possibility of Villa pulling off a win or securing a draw on opening day holds significant weight.

Best bet – Aston/Draw Double Chance

An evenly contested match-up between Chelsea and Liverpool could be on the cards for the opening weekend. Liverpool’s road struggles last season could well continue in this first part of the season, especially in this first trip to London. The addition of Alexis Mac Allister, a promising midfield talent, might be a game-changer yet it might take some time for the Argentine to adapt to Klopp’s ideas.

Meanwhile, Chelsea, despite their massive spending spree, might be grappling with a new manager’s philosophy and an overflowing squad that might still lack a formidable striker. This potential vulnerability, especially against Liverpool’s potent offense, sets the stage for a potentially exciting showdown.

Despite Liverpool’s away woes, I don’t see Chelsea winning and considering both sides’ strengths and uncertainties, a draw could very well be a realistic outcome in this high-profile opener.

Best bet – Draw

Following a turbulent relegation struggle, Crystal Palace managed to secure their safety in the league last season, thanks to the return of Roy Hodgson. However, they could face a stern test in their 2023/24 opener against Sheffield United.

Uncertainty surrounds the managerial future at Palace, which can pose a challenge heading into the new season. The Eagles found solace in their home ground performances during the last campaign, so commencing the season away from home might prove tricky.

On the other hand, Sheffield United, fresh from their Championship promotion, had a commendable home record, winning 16 out of 23 matches at Bramall Lane. Therefore, an opening-day victory for the Blades could be a promising bet, considering these factors.

Best bet – Sheffield United to Win

Despite the speculation that Tottenham might struggle initially under Ange Postecoglou, it’s essential to remember that Spurs have a history of bouncing back and making significant strides as the season progresses. Their transfer dealings, under the watchful eye of Daniel Levy, tend to pick up pace later in the window, bringing in reinforcements when needed.

Their season opener is set against Brentford, a team that capitalized on Manchester United’s early hiccups last season. However, it’s unlikely that history will repeat itself with a 4-0 victory for the Bees. Tottenham, with their renowned resilience and potential to strengthen their squad, could surprise many by notching a win, turning the odds in their favor as the season unfolds.

Best bet – Tottenham to Win

While West Ham triumphed in the Europa Conference League last season, their Premier League campaign was notably challenging. This, coupled with the anticipated departure of star player Declan Rice, might slightly unsettle the team ahead of their opener against Bournemouth.

Despite their impressive first season in the top flight, Bournemouth’s 39 points perhaps flatter their performance, hinting at a challenging second season. This, along with West Ham’s squad full of quality, can set the stage for an intriguing clash.

In light of these factors, predicting an outright winner becomes challenging. Hence, a draw might be a potential outcome for this fixture, considering both sides’ equal potential to either rise to the occasion or falter under the pressure and might welcome starting by avoiding a defeat.

Best bet – Draw

Erik Ten Hag’s initial season at Manchester United saw him extract an impressive performance from the team, a momentum expected to roll into their first-round face-off against Wolves.

United’s remarkable end to the last season with four consecutive Premier League victories demonstrates their potential, especially with plans to strengthen their team to better compete in the Champions League.

On the other hand, Wolves may head into the new season without key playmaker Ruben Neves. The multiple transformations envisaged at Molineux cast a shadow of uncertainty on the team’s initial performances under Julen Lopetegui.

Given United’s impressive streak of 30 home games without defeat since last September, they look poised to kick off the new season on a positive note, potentially at Wolves’ expense.

Best bet –  Manchester United to Win
